Description:
An English Carved Oak Welsh Dresser, late 19th c., Jas. Schoolbred & Co., labeled, molded cornice, scalloped frieze, three shelves flanked by arched paneled cupboard doors, base with two drawers and cupboard doors, turned legs, stretcher base, height 82 in., width 72 in., depth 21 3/4 in.
Note: Schoolbred & Co. was a high-end London firm working c. 1870. The firm had a large exhibit at the Philadelphia Centennial Exhibition of 1876.
